Your health is influenced by more than food alone. Nutrition, sleep, stress, movement, environment, and daily habits all interact to shape how you feel and function.
The goal of functional nutrition counseling is not to create dependence on a practitioner, but to help you develop awareness, tools, and confidence to make informed choices about your own health.
At KiStones, I take a personalized, whole-person approach to nutrition counseling. Rather than starting with generic recommendations, we begin by understanding your unique history, current challenges, goals, and lifestyle. Together, we identify practical, sustainable strategies to support your wellness and help you build the foundations for lasting change.

The Foundational Wellness Assessment
Every new nutrition client begins with a Foundational Wellness Assessment - a comprehensive assessment designed to create a detailed picture of you! This in-depth process allows us to explore the many factors that influence your health and identify areas where nutrition and lifestyle strategies may support your goals.
The Foundational Wellness Assessment is a deep dive into the factors that may be influencing your current health and well-being, including:
Nutrition patterns and dietary habits
Health history and timeline
Digestion and gut health
Sleep and stress patterns
Lifestyle factors
Current goals
The process includes:
Initial Consultation - Timeline Session (60 minutes)
We discuss your health history, concerns, and current lifestyle to map out factors impacting your health. After your initial consultation, we will schedule your follow-up session together.
Personalized Review & Analysis (60-90 minutes)
I carefully review your information, create a timeline of your health history, map out a functional matrix of all the factors at play and prepare individualized recommendations based on your needs.
Follow-Up Consultation - Nutrition Counseling (60 minutes)
We discuss findings, recommendations, and next steps to create an actionable plan.
This comprehensive process allows us to move beyond surface-level recommendations and create a thoughtful starting point for your wellness journey.
